#c05348 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c05348 is composed of 75.3% red, 32.5%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.8% magenta, 62.5%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 5.5 degrees, a saturation of 48.8% and a lightness of 51.8%. #c05348 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a690 with #810000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#c05348 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c05348 has RGB values of R:192, G:83,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.57, Y:0.63,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12604232.
